UNIVERSAL CITY, Calif. -- August 30, 2005 -- The newest DVD collection of NBC's highly rated crime series Law & Order: SVU hits retail shelves September 27, 2005, from Universal Studios Home Entertainment. Spawned from one of the most successful brands in television history, creator-executive producer Dick Wolf's Law & Order: SVU has consistently captivated viewers and critics alike with its provocative storylines ripped straight from today's headlines. With fans of the show demonstrating a tremendous appetite for Law & Order programming, viewers can truly enjoy the additional bonus materials and extensive behind-the-scenes footage exclusive to the DVD.

The ten-time Emmy-nominated series chronicles the gritty, day-to-day world of the New York Police Department's elite Special Victims Unit and stars Christopher Meloni as Detective Elliot Stabler and Mariska Hargitay in her Golden Globe Award-winning role as Detective Olivia Benson. Season Two also features the addition of Ice-T as Detective Odafin Tutuola and B.D Wong as forensic psychiatrist George Huang. Dann Florek, Richard Belzer and Stephanie March round out the powerful cast of Law & Order: SVU-The Second Year, which also boasts a star-studded guest roster including Eric Roberts, Margot Kidder, Richard Thomas, Karen Allen, Chad Lowe and others. Timed to coincide with the September 20, 2005, Law & Order: SVU Season Seven premiere on NBC, the three-disc collection arrives in stores on September 27, 2005 priced at $59.98 SRP.

The brainchild of Law & Order brand creator-executive producer Dick Wolf, Law & Order: Special Victims Unit has consistently been one of NBC's top performers, and regularly wins its Tuesday time period, monopolizing audiences by a wide margin in ratings, share and demographics. The series also continues to break records with its dual-window USA Network airings, and has been renewed through 2006. This year the show received three Emmy Award nominations, one for Hargitay (her second) as Outstanding Lead Actress in a Drama Series, and two for Outstanding Guest Actress in a Drama Series category (Amanda Plummer and Angela Lansbury). Wolf's additional series, the original Law & Order and Law & Order: Criminal Intent, have met with equally loyal popular and critical acclaim and their highly collectible full season DVD collections have been consistent best sellers. Law & Order: Special Victims Unit is a Wolf Films production in association with NBC Universal Television Studio.

SYNOPSIS

Each episode of this hard-hitting and emotionally charged drama follows an investigation by the New York Police Department's elite Special Victims Unit. The series centers on Detective Elliot Stabler (Christopher Meloni), a seasoned, seen-it-all veteran of the unit, and his tough but compassionate partner, Detective Olivia Benson (Mariska Hargitay), as they try to solve the city's most heinous crimes. Joining them in their fight against sexual predators are Detectives John Munch (Richard Belzer) and Odafin "Fin" Tutuola (Ice-T), forensic psychiatrist George Huang (B.D.Wong), Assistant District Attorney Casey Novak (Diane Neal) and their tough but supportive supervisor, Captain Donald Cragen (Dann Florek, reprising his Law & Order role).
